Boswellia frereana essential oil, also known as Frankincense Frereana, is derived from the resin of the Boswellia frereana tree. It has a warm, woody, and spicy aroma and is commonly used in aromatherapy for its therapeutic properties. Here are some of the potential benefits and aromatherapy uses of Boswellia frereana essential oil:

  1. Reduces inflammation: Boswellia frereana essential oil has anti-inflammatory properties that may help reduce inflammation in the body. It is often used in aromatherapy to ease joint pain and muscle aches.

  2. Boosts immunity: Boswellia frereana essential oil may help strengthen the immune system due to its antimicrobial properties. It is often used in aromatherapy to promote overall wellness and prevent illness.

  3. Relieves stress and anxiety: Boswellia frereana essential oil has a calming effect on the mind and body. It can help reduce stress and anxiety, improve mood, and promote relaxation. It is often used in aromatherapy to promote emotional well-being.

  4. Improves respiratory health: Boswellia frereana essential oil may help improve respiratory health by reducing inflammation and clearing the airways. It is often used in aromatherapy to ease symptoms of asthma, bronchitis, and other respiratory conditions.

  5. Enhances skin health: Boswellia frereana essential oil has antibacterial and anti-inflammatory properties that may help improve skin health. It is often used in aromatherapy to treat acne, scars, and other skin conditions.

To use Boswellia frereana essential oil in aromatherapy, it can be diffused in a diffuser or added to a carrier oil and applied topically. However, it is important to dilute the essential oil before applying it to the skin as it can be irritating in its pure form. It is also important to consult with a qualified aromatherapist before using any essential oils for therapeutic purposes.
